36Job Description:This is a unique setting which is seeking a Deputy Nursery Manager to join the nursery in the Harrow area. This is a purpose built setting which offers spacious, airy rooms and a large outdoor area, all extremely well resourced and with excellent facilities. This nursery offers a warm, welcoming, and inclusive environment where children can explore, learn, and grow. They are close to the tube, are well served by local bus routes and can also offer free parking onsite.

They are seeking a Deputy Nursery Manager who will work as part of the nursery management team, to ensure the setting has the right staff, culture, policies and resources to deliver the highest standards of childcare and early years education.

This role is full time 5 days per week (40 hours). Responsibilities:

  • Assist the Nursery Manager in the day-to-day running of the nursery, ensuring high standards of care and education
  • Oversee the planning and implementation of the curriculum ensuring that it meets the needs of all children
  • Foster strong relationships with children, parents, and staff to create a positive and collaborative community
  • Support the Nursery Manager in managing staff, including training, mentoring, and performance reviews
  • Handle administrative tasks, including scheduling, record-keeping, and managing budgets
  • Step in for the Nursery Manager when they are absent, ensuring smooth operation and continuity of care

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:

  • Minimum Level 3 Early Years Qualification (or equivalent); higher qualifications preferred
  • Significant experience in an early years setting, with previous management or supervisory experience
  • Strong knowledge of early childhood education theories and practices
  • Excellent leadership, organizational, and communication skills
  • A genuine passion for working with young children and supporting their development
